Obituaries are often written in collaboration with the funeral home, and may be shared online, in print, or both. Tributes, on the other hand, can take many forms, from online memorials and video presentations to customized memory books and candles. The key is to find a format that resonates with the family's style and preferences. ### **What Is the Difference Between an Obituary and a Tribute?** Obituaries and tributes serve different purposes. An obituary is a public announcement of a person's death, typically including basic information such as their name, age, and cause of death.

Tributes, by contrast, focus on honoring the person's life, often sharing stories, memories, and photos that celebrate their spirit and legacy. ### **How Long Does It Take to Create an Obituary or Tribute?** The length of time it takes to create an obituary or tribute can vary depending on the complexity of the project and the family's needs. Typically, funeral homes will work closely with the family to gather information and create a draft within a few days or weeks. ### **What Are Some Common Mistakes to Avoid When Creating an Obituary or Tribute?** While creating an obituary or tribute can be a meaningful experience, there are some common mistakes to avoid. These include: not verifying the accuracy of the information, not giving enough thought to the language and tone, and not considering the feelings of all those involved. ### **What Opportunities Exist for Families Creating Obituaries or Tributes?** By creating an obituary or tribute, families can take advantage of several opportunities, including: honoring their loved one in a meaningful way, connecting with others who may have known the person, and preserving memories and stories for future generations.
